One such compelling illustration that bolsters this belief is Bandrek – a traditional hot beverage native to the Indonesian region of West Java.

Bandrek, defined by its cozy warmth and soothing sweetness, holds a special place in the rich food and drink culture of Indonesia. It is far more than just a beverage, it stands as an emblem of cultural identity and historical significance. Crafted from a harmonious blend of ginger, brown sugar and cloves, this drink hits an irresistible balance between sweet and spicy kick. Variations often include the fragrant pandan leaf, tamarind, and a sprinkle of cinnamon, serving up a savory aroma and a delightful dance of flavors on your tastebuds. Some versions even carry aromatic pandan leaves and exotic condiments like lemongrass.

The roots of Bandrek trail back to the native Sundanese people who braved the colder, high-altitude climates of West Java. It was within these chilly environs that Bandrek sprung forth as a source of warmth and comfort. This ginger-based concoction not only warms up the body, but it also boosts the immune system. The process revealed: How to prepare Bandrek

Armed with a basic understanding of Bandrek’s ingredients, history, and bold flavor, let’s delve into the process of creating this renowned Indonesian beverage at home. It’s an inviting challenge to any food enthusiast, a promise of a warm, aromatic, and refreshingly different brew.

The first step in crafting Bandrek involves preparing the fresh ingredients. You will need to peel and grate or crush the ginger root, just enough to release its potent juice, but not to the point it becomes pulpy. The crushed ginger will provide that distinct sting that is synonymous with Bandrek. Lemongrass should also be crushed to expose its fervent core, enabling a sublime essence to permeate the brew.

Next comes the infusion process. Like brewing a robust chai, this is a pivotal step that demands precision and patience. Add water to a pot, bring it to a simmer and then envelop it with spices like the crushed ginger, fragrant clove, the versatile pandan leaf, and the aromatic cinnamon. These core ingredients build Bandrek’s strong flavors, each playing an integral role in the final symphony of taste.

Take the time to steep these spices in water for around 15 to 20 minutes. This ensures the maximum extraction of their essences. Rest assured, your kitchen will soon be filled with an intoxicating aroma that is bound to tantalize your senses.

After this, strain the mixture. As tempting as it might be to expedite the procedure, remember that haste can interrupt the perfect balance of flavors. Patience is a cardinal virtue in the art of culinary creation.

The final, but crucial, step is the addition of brown sugar. It gives Bandrek its soothing sweetness, creating a symphony with the robust spices. A bit of tamarind is often added at this stage for a slight tangy twist that breaks through the harmonious sweetness and spice.

Once all these ingredients have beautifully melded together, serve it hot, perhaps with a side of Indonesian snacks for an authentic experience. The final product is a fragrant, spicy, and sweet beverage that dances on your palate, enveloping you in a comforting, gastronomic embrace.
